Overview
Discover the cultural heart of Penang on this 4–5 hour George Town Heritage Walk, a guided journey through the city’s most iconic historical and religious landmarks. Explore St. George’s Church, Goddess of Mercy Temple, Sri Mahamariamman Temple, Kapitan Keling Mosque, Little India, and George Town’s famous street art as your English-speaking guide shares stories that bring the city’s rich multicultural heritage to life.
This curated route also includes a rare visit to a traditional Joss Stick Maker, offering an intimate look into Penang’s living heritage craftsmanship, as well as entrance to the magnificent Khoo Kongsi (KKS) clan house. For an added nostalgic touch, guests may opt for a trishaw ride at an additional fee. Seamless and educational, this walk is the perfect way to experience George Town’s UNESCO-worthy charm up close.
